Is it hard for an LLC to get a loan?

Some loans may be specifically marketed as LLC loans, but LLCs can apply for many standard business loans. If you have an LLC, you should have no trouble finding a business loan. You will need to qualify for the business loan requirements, but typically, lenders will give loans to multiple types of businesses.

How does an LLC get approved for a loan?

Lenders typically review the LLC's credit score, annual revenue and time in business before approving the loan, making it difficult for less established LLCs to qualify. Personal guarantees may be required.

Can you borrow from your LLC?

Any member of an LLC can borrow money from it. However, if the LLC has other members, they must approve the loan and report their authorization in the LLC's minutes. An advance of funds to a member can only be considered a loan if the LLC creates a legally enforceable promissory note for the repayment of the loan.

Can a new LLC get an SBA loan?

SBA Business Loan for New LLC: Your Options. Two primary SBA loan options are available for LLCs and other small businesses in need of financing: the SBA 7(a) loan and SBA 504 loan. Each has specific ways funds can be used, and they offer different loan terms and loan limits.

Does your EIN have a credit score?

Since businesses don't have Social Security numbers, they're instead tracked by their name, address and employer identification number, also known as an EIN. Unlike personal credit scores, business credit scores are publicly available.

What happens if an LLC defaults on a loan?

Loan guarantees: If you personally guarantee a loan to the LLC, creditors can pursue your personal assets if the loan defaults. Pledging personal assets as collateral: If you pledge your personal assets as collateral against a business loan, a creditor could seize your property in the event of a default.

Are you personally liable for an LLC loan?

A corporation or LLC's owners may also be held personally liable if they are found to have committed fraud. If the owner made fraudulent representations or omissions when applying for a business loan, he or she can be held personally responsible for the resulting harm to the creditor and risk losing personal assets.

Can an LLC lend money to an individual?

Yes, you can. As the owner of an LLC, you have the authority to lend money to individuals or other businesses. However, it's essential to document the loan terms and ensure that it aligns with your LLC's operating agreement.

How big of a loan can a new LLC get?

How much of a business loan you can get depends on your business's annual gross sales, creditworthiness, current debts, the type of financing, and the chosen lender. In general, lenders will only provide loans up to 10% to 30% of your annual revenue to ensure you have the means for repayment.

What disqualifies you from getting an SBA loan?

The most common reasons SBA loans are denied are poor credit, too much existing debt, or insufficient collateral. Other reasons include: Prior bankruptcy. Negative taxable income.

How long does it take to establish credit for an LLC?

There's no set time limit for how long you need to have been in business to take out a line of credit. However, many lenders require two years. Some may be willing to work with you if you've only been in business for one year or, more rarely, six months. Don't expect to get the best terms, though.

Does opening an LLC hurt your credit?

If your LLC has debts taken out in the company's name, only the LLC's business credit report will be impacted by whether you repay your debts on time. An LLC loan will only impact your personal credit if you cosign or guarantee it. If you don't do so, your credit report will remain unaffected.

How does LLC line of credit work?

A small business line of credit is subject to credit review and annual renewal, and is revolving, like a credit card: Interest begins to accumulate once you draw funds, and the amount you pay (except for interest) is again available to be borrowed as you pay down your balance.

What does your business credit score start at?

When it comes to business credit scores, you may notice that they don't fall in the same numerical range as personal credit scores. Most business credit scores are ranked on a scale of 0 to 100, while business scores using the FICO Small Business Scoring Service (FICO SBSS) range from 0 to 300.
